Sorts Of Lendings Worth Considering Right After Graduation



Not every lending works the same way, and recognizing the differences matters greater than the majority of people understand at twenty-two.



Personal Installment Loans



Individual installment financings give debtors a fixed amount upfront, which they pay off in equal monthly installments over an established term. For a person that requires to cover relocating expenses from an university apartment to an initial expert home in the Waterfront area, this structure offers predictability. Month-to-month settlements stay constant, making it simpler to budget plan around an entry-level salary.



The key is obtaining just what is really needed. Lenders that concentrate on offering communities like the Inland Empire often offer amounts tailored to practical early-career incomes, so the repayment schedule continues to be convenient from the first day.



Safe vs. Unsecured Finances



A secured financing requires security, typically a car or interest-bearing accounts, while an unprotected lending counts simply on creditworthiness. Graduates with a solid credit report developed via student charge card or on-time expense repayments have a tendency to qualify for far better unsafe terms. Those with minimal credit report might find that a secured loan supplies a reduced interest rate and a useful opportunity to construct their credit rating account further.



For anybody living near Central Opportunity Riverside, CA, vehicle-secured finances are worthy of specific attention given exactly how transportation-dependent the area is. A vehicle that already holds equity can function as security for a car loan that consolidates various other smaller sized debts or funds a specialist accreditation course.



Credit Report Home Builder Loans



Debt home builder lendings work in different ways from conventional loans. The debtor makes regular monthly payments into a safeguarded account, and the lender records those payments to the credit scores bureaus. At the end of the term, the customer gets the accumulated funds. For a current grad that has little to no credit history, this item prepares for getting approved for larger loans within twelve to eighteen months.



What Graduates in Riverside Must Know Prior To Applying



Lenders examine several elements: credit score, revenue, existing debt, and employment condition. Grads that line these up beforehand give themselves a real benefit.



Inspect Your Credit Scores Record First



Prior to walking into any financial institution, pull a credit rating report and check it for errors. A single unreliable late repayment or an account that was never appropriately shut can drag a score down unnecessarily. Fixing errors takes time, so starting this procedure in May or early June collections points up cleanly prior to submitting applications.

Review the Fine Print on Charges



Origination charges, early repayment fines, and late payment charges vary widely across loan providers. A lending with a slightly higher rate of interest yet no source cost can cost much less in total than one with a lower price that fees three percent upfront. New graduates that take twenty mins to contrast overall finance expenses instead of just month-to-month payments consistently appear ahead.

Build an Emergency Fund Together With Payment



This seems official source counterintuitive, however even saving fifty bucks each month right into a separate account while paying off a financing creates a barrier that avoids future borrowing. Without that barrier, a single automobile repair service or clinical copay can push somebody right into a cycle of high-interest credit scores usage that undoes the progress developed by a well-managed installment car loan.
